So reliable

Over 14 years I only needed new brakes and tune-ups, and new exhaust system (Midwest winters). This car is a beast! Everyone loved driving in it, the interior is huge, super smooth and quiet ride, great pick-up, decent mileage. Only reasons I traded mine in was struts were due to be replaced and I was looking for a vehicle with AWD. Exterior build and interior are a bit dated but wow Centuries would make super reliable good buys for used cars if you can find them, I still see a lot of them on the road.

Watch out for tires coming off while driving

This car was handed down to me by my late great-grandfather. He took great care of it so I was excited to have such a well taken care of and clean car. One day, driving down the thruway in NY going about 70mph, the front passenger tire literally flew off the car. In many cases, the car would have lost control but for some reason I was able to keep control of the car and gently steer it into the shoulder where it finally came to a stop. The entire front right side of the car was destroyed from the damage the tire did when it flew off. I will never drive another Buick again.
